A Venus flytrap uses enzymes to digest a captured prey, whether it is an insect, small frog, etc. It might take a week or so to digest an insect, and not all of it will be consumed. The exoskeleton will be left, for instance. An experiment demonstrated that Venus flytrap can eat human flesh. howarth and associates nj

WebbYou can pot multiple Venus flytrap plants in one pot, just be sure to give them some horizontal growth room, about 3″ periphery at minimum. You should only pot Flytraps and Capensis plants together, not Pitcher Plants, as Pitcher Plants require much more water, and too much water can rot your Venus Flytraps. WebbThe Venus flytrap is a small plant whose structure can be described as a rosette of four to seven leaves, which arise from a short subterranean stem that is actually a bulb-like object. Each stem reaches a maximum size of about three to ten centimeters, depending on the time of year; [25] longer leaves with robust traps are usually formed after flowering.

Webb10 mars 2024 · Birch Seed Soil Carnivorous Plant Soil. Birch Seed Soils truly provides wonderful soil for Venus flytraps. With an acidic pH range of 3.5 to 4.5, this soil mix is suitable for acid-loving Venus flytraps. For moisture retention and drainage, the soil is a 60/40 combination of sphagnum peat moss and perlite.
